TARANAKI OIL.
* NEW VEIN STRU€K. Pr(ft.i Association. , NEW PLYMOUTH, Sept. 25.' The Taranaki Oil Wells report speaks encouragingly of the operations at No. 2 well, which has been deepened and re-cased and is now very active. A new gas vein was struck this morning at 2750 ft, and, after two hours, began to force oil to the surface. It is still violent, aud the oil is improving. The rotary bore, and No. 3 also, contirfue to yield well.
